Cornerstone Base Station manages the commissioning, calibration and maintenance of industrial instruments. Base Station supports HART and conventional instrumentation. Create your HART database simply by connecting anywhere on the instrument loop. Base Station maintains a comprehensive instrument data base, with individual histories of the configuration, test, calibration and maintenance activities performed on each instrument.

Base Station stays current with the standard HART tables distributed by the HART Communication Foundation. Using these tables and the HART universal and common practice command sets, Base Station can communicate with any HART compliant device, even those not yet registered in the tables. Access to device specific parameters and functions is accomplished through a Cornerstone Model Support Library customized to the individual device.
Use Base Station to create a central HART maintenance station with remote access to field devices over networks of HART compatible multiplexers. Periodically scanned HART process data and device status retrieved over these network connections are then accessible by other applications via Dynamic Data Exchange (DDE).
The Base Station user interface is organized into separate windows corresponding to the major application functions. You enter the Main window through the password protected sign-on dialog box. The Main window provides menu access to setup functions and contains the Cornerstone Event Log in its display area. Located in the lower portion of the Main window are the icons of the other Cornerstone windows: Instrument Directory, Database, HART Comm, Conventional, History, Reports, Docking, Comm Manager and Diagrams.
